Working as an Hourly Dialysis Technician in Pinellas Park
Considering the financial implications of hourly pay for dialysis technicians in Pinellas Park, a part-time worker committed to a 24-hour workweek can anticipate an annual take-home income significantly lower than their full-time counterparts. In contrast, per-diem dialysis technicians often enjoy higher billing rates, typically ranging from $25 to $38 per hour, with home dialysis trainers earning around $30 to $45 per hour depending on their employer and settings. While travel contracts for dialysis technicians are less common compared to nursing, they can be lucrative, offering between $1,200 and $1,800 per week. Moreover, the type of employer can significantly influence salary, with outpatient chains like Fresenius and DaVita dominating the market and often standardizing pay scales. Many technicians might choose jobs with lower hourly wages in exchange for comprehensive health insurance benefits, underlining the importance of weighing salary against job perks. For those looking to negotiate pay in Pinellas Park, articulating specific skill sets relevant to dialysis care can lead to better compensation in discussions with potential employers.
